hey! this problem has been bugging me cs1525 unexpected symbol `quaternion' can you please help we with this problem.

                       Quaternion.transrot = Quaternion.LookRotation(newposition - this.transform.position, Vector3.up);
         graphics.transform.rotation = Quaternion.Slerp(transRot, graphics.transform.rotation, 0.2f);
     }
 }

 [PunRPC]
 public void RecievedMove(Vector3 movePos)
 {
     newposition = movePos;
 }

}

I'm really sorry for how long this took me, but I think I found a solution. I can't exactly be sure what you were looking for but I copied your script and debugged for about an hour. I came up with this: using UnityEngine; using System.Collections;

 public class RecievedMovement : MonoBehaviour 
 {
 Vector3 newPosition; 
 public float speed; 
 public float walkRange; 
 public GameObject graphics; 
 
     void Start() 
     {
         newPosition = this.transform.position;
     }
 
     void Update() 
     {
         Quaternion transRot = Quaternion.LookRotation(newPosition - this.transform.position, Vector3.up);
 
         graphics.transform.rotation = Quaternion.Slerp(transRot, graphics.transform.rotation, 0.2f);
 
         if (Vector3.Distance(newPosition, this.transform.position) > walkRange) 
         { 
             this.transform.position = Vector3.MoveTowards (this.transform.position, newPosition, speed * Time.deltaTime);
         }
     }
         
 
     void RecievedMove(Vector3 movePos)
     {
         newPosition = movePos;
     }
 }

Get back to me as soon as you can if this doesn't work.
